Land Excavation in Houston, TX

Land excavation services involve the removal or redistribution of soil, rock, or other materials from a property to prepare for construction, landscaping, or drainage projects. These services typically cover tasks such as grading, trenching, foundation preparation, and site clearing, helping property owners create a stable and level surface for various projects like building a new home, installing a driveway, or creating a backyard pond. Before requesting excavation services, property owners should understand the scope of their project, site accessibility, and any potential permits or restrictions that may apply in the area.

Homeowners considering excavation should evaluate the existing land conditions, including soil stability and drainage patterns, to ensure the project’s success. It’s also important to communicate specific goals, such as desired grading levels or excavation depth, to ensure the work aligns with the property’s needs. Understanding the potential impact on existing structures, underground utilities, and local regulations can help streamline the process and avoid delays or complications.

Project Types

Common Land Excavation Jobs

Land clearing - preparing property for construction or landscaping by removing trees, shrubs, and debris.

Site grading - leveling the land to ensure proper drainage and a stable foundation.

Excavation for foundations - digging the necessary space for building footings and basement structures.

Driveway and pathway excavation - creating level surfaces for driveways, walkways, and patios.

Utility trenching - excavating trenches for installing water, sewer, or electrical lines.

Land reshaping - modifying the terrain to improve drainage, aesthetics, or usability.

Land Excavation Questions

What types of projects require land excavation services? Land excavation is often needed for new construction, landscaping, drainage improvements, or site preparation before building.

How deep can excavation services go? Excavation depths vary based on project requirements, typically ranging from a few inches to several feet underground.

What should property owners know before starting excavation? It's important to assess existing underground utilities and obtain necessary permits before excavation begins.

Can excavation services help with uneven or sloped land? Yes, excavation can level or reshape land to create a stable foundation for construction or landscaping.
